Ferry redeployment cuts capacity on Mallaig–Armadale route until early August
By Jamie McDonald Ferry redeployment cuts capacity on Mallaig–Armadale route until early August Ferry services between Mallaig and Armadale will operate with reduced capacity until at least 6 August after CalMac redeployed MV Loch Bhrusda to cover a vessel breakdown elsewhere in the network. Sabhal Mòr Ostaig’s Fàs Building set to reopen after £4m boost
By Jamie McDonald Sabhal Mòr Ostaig is to receive £4 million from the Scottish Government to reopen one of its key centres. The Fàs building, which has been out of use since 2022, will be refurbished to become the new Centre for Gaelic Creativity.
